Question 2: What is the maximum wind speed at which work on a tower scaffold should generally cease?
- 10 mph
- 17 mph (Beaufort Force 4) (Correct answer)
- 30 mph
- 50 mph
Correct answer: 17 mph (Beaufort Force 4)
PASMA recommends that work ceases when wind speeds reach 17 mph (Beaufort Force 4), at which point small branches move and dust/paper is raised. Tower scaffolds have large surface areas and are particularly susceptible to wind forces.

Question 5: Which regulation requires that a rescue plan is in place before work at height commences?
- The Noise at Work Regulations 2005
- The Work at Height Regulations 2005 (Correct answer)
- The Electricity at Work Regulations 1989
- The Manual Handling Operations Regulations 1992
Correct answer: The Work at Height Regulations 2005
Regulation 4 of WAHR 2005 requires planning for emergencies and rescue. A rescue plan must be in place before work at height begins, so that in the event of a fall or equipment failure, rescue can be carried out promptly.
Question 6: What is the potential penalty for serious breaches of the Work at Height Regulations 2005?
- A verbal warning only
- An unlimited fine and/or up to 2 years' imprisonment (Correct answer)
- A fixed penalty notice of £100
- Suspension of the company's website
Correct answer: An unlimited fine and/or up to 2 years' imprisonment
Breaches of health and safety regulations enforced under HSWA 1974 can result in unlimited fines in either the Magistrates' or Crown Court. Individuals (including directors) can face up to 2 years' imprisonment for serious offences.
